Incident Narrative
ON 8/19/2021 NEW PIPING WAS INSTALLED AT COUNTY ROAD 20 (CR20). TIE-IN WORK CONSISTED OF TWO TIE-IN WELDS; ONE ON THE NORTH END AND ONE ON THE SOUTH END, AND FIVE BOLT UPS. SOME OF THE BOLT UPS WERE ON ANSI #600 FLANGES AND SOME WERE ON ANSI #900 FLANGES. THE PIPE INSTALLATION WORK WAS ACCOMPLISHED BY A COMBINATION OF THE SINCLAIR CONSTRUCTION GROUP AND A CONTRACTOR. THE SINCLAIR PERSONNEL ACTED AS THE QUALIFIED OQ INDIVIDUALS OBSERVING OTHER NON-QUALIFIED OQ INDIVIDUALS (CONTRACTOR PERSONNEL) IN ACCORDANCE WITH SECTION 6.6 IN SINCLAIR'S OQ WRITTEN PLAN. DURING NORMAL OPERATIONS THE MOV TO THE THIRD-PARTY SHIPPER IS OPEN AND LINE PRESSURE RANGES BETWEEN 70 PSI AND 170 PSI DEPENDING ON INCOMING FLOW RATES INTO THE SYSTEM. ON 10/6/21 SINCLAIR OPERATIONS PERSONNEL ALIGNED THE CR20 PIG TRAPS FOR PERIODIC MAINTENANCE PIGGING. PART OF THIS PROCESS IS TO CLOSE A VALVE (CR20 MOV) TO THE THIRD-PARTY SHIPPER ENABLING ALL FLOW TO GO NORTH TO THE NORTH TRAP. DURING MAINTENANCE PIGGING NORMAL OPERATING PRESSURE RANGES BETWEEN 600 PSI AND 800 PSI. AT 07:30 THE CR20 MOV WAS CLOSED AND A PIG WAS LAUNCHED WITHOUT INCIDENT. SOME TIME LATER A LEAK DEVELOPED AT A FLANGE ON THE NORTH LINE. UPON DISCOVERY OF THE LEAK THE CR20 MOV WAS OPENED, REDUCING THE PRESSURE AND LEAK FLOW RATE. FURTHER ISOLATION OF THE LEAKING FLANGE ENSUED. REMAINING LINE PRESSURE AND LINE FILL AT THE FLANGE WAS THEN DRAINED INTO THE SUMP. UPON DISASSEMBLY OF THE ANSI #900 FLANGE IT WAS DISCOVERED THAT THE GASKET USED WAS A MISTAKENLY INSTALLED ANSI #600 GASKET. THIS GASKET WAS RESTING ON THE BOTTOM BOLTS. SOME OF THE WINDINGS WERE UNRAVELING AND IT WAS OBSERVED THE SEALING SURFACE OF THE GASKET AT THE 6 O'CLOCK POSITION WAS MISSHAPEN. THE OUTSIDE DIAMETER OF A PROPERLY SIZED GASKET IS DESIGNED SUCH THAT IT SELF-CENTERS ON THE FLANGE WHEN RESTING ON THE BOLTS. THEREFORE THE INSIDE DIAMETER OF THE #600 GASKET DID NOT LINE UP WITH THE INSIDE DIAMETER OF THE FLANGE BORE. MORE IMPORTANTLY, THE SEALING SURFACE OF THE RAISED FACE OF THE FLANGE ONLY PARTIALLY ALIGNED WITH THE SEALING SURFACE OF THE GASKET. A NEW ANSI #900 GASKET AND NEW BOLTS WERE INSTALLED AND THE FLANGE WAS PROPERLY TIGHTENED. A VISUAL INSPECTION WAS PERFORMED ON THE NEW GASKET ASSEMBLY ONCE LINE PRESSURE HAD STABILIZED TO ENSURE THE FLANGE WAS NOT LEAKING.
